Water damage is a pervasive issue that may affect properties and companies alike. Understanding the common causes of water damage is an important step in stopping it. Regular maintenance and being vigilant can save vital money and time.


One of the most frequent causes of water damage is plumbing leaks. These can occur due to aging pipes, unfastened fittings, or excessive water pressure. Simple leaks can progressively drip over time, inflicting extensive damage to surrounding materials, together with drywall, flooring, and insulation.

Another vital wrongdoer is roof leaks. A poorly maintained roof, gaps in flashing, or lacking shingles can lead to rainwater coming into a building. This can outcome in mold development, structural damage, and deteriorated insulation, further aggravating the scenario.


Severe weather occasions can also result in significant water damage. Heavy rains and storms can overwhelm drainage methods, causing flooding in basements and decrease ranges of a property. Ensuring correct drainage and gutters might help redirect rainwater away from the construction.


Furthermore, appliances similar to washing machines and dishwashers are common sources of water damage once they malfunction. Hoses can put on out, leading to leaks or bursts. Regular inspection of all appliance connections can prevent such incidents.

Floods are another apparent reason for water damage. These might occur because of pure disasters or even heavy rainfall. Living in flood-prone areas necessitates the set up of sump pumps and flood obstacles. They can provide a vital line of protection against potential flooding.


Humidity can even cause issues, particularly in areas vulnerable to excessive moisture levels. Excess humidity can lead to condensation on walls and ceilings, leading to mold development. Using dehumidifiers may help handle indoor humidity levels effectively and forestall mold issues.

Foundation cracks could go unnoticed, but they'll lead to vital water intrusion. Water can seep by way of these cracks during rains, leading to moisture in basements or crawlspaces. Regular inspections and maintenance of the muse can considerably mitigate this risk.

Another contributing issue to water damage is poor landscaping. Sloping landscapes can direct water in path of a home somewhat than away from it. Proper grading ensures that water is channeled away from the inspiration, reducing the danger of groundwater infiltration.

  • Leaking roofs can enable rainwater to seep in; regularly examine and maintain roof shingles and flashing.

  • Clogged gutters can lead to overflow, inflicting water to pool near the inspiration; clear and clear gutters a minimum of twice a year.

  • Broken pipes in walls or underneath sinks could cause vital damage; periodically verify for signs of leaks and consider upgrading old plumbing.

  • Overflowing bathtubs or bogs can rapidly lead to extensive damage; set up overflow safety and always monitor water levels.

  • High humidity ranges can result in condensation and mold growth; use dehumidifiers in damp areas to maintain optimum humidity levels.

  • Faulty home equipment like washing machines or dishwashers may cause leaks; routinely verify hoses and connections for wear and tear.

  • Flooding from heavy storms can impression houses; consider elevating appliances and putting in sump pumps in flood-prone areas.

  • Irrigation methods could malfunction and overwater areas, creating pooling; schedule common maintenance checks on automated systems.

  • Snowmelt can contribute to basement flooding; ensure proper drainage around your property and consider basement waterproofing options.
